Jobs for Percussion Instruments Grads in Montana
In this state, there are 450 people employed in jobs related to a Percussion Instruments degree, compared to 136,240 nationwide.
Wages for Percussion Instruments Jobs in Montana
A typical salary for a Percussion Instruments grad in the state is $78,140, compared to a typical salary of $102,240 nationwide.
